- The distance between Olivia, Mn, Usa and Segou, Mali is approximately 8,876 km or 5,515 mi.
- To reach Olivia, Mn in this distance one would set out from Segou bearing 313.9°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Olivia, Mn bearing 261.2° or W .
- Olivia, Mn has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Segou has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Olivia, Mn is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Segou is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 21.5 °C (38.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 27 °C (48.6°F) more in Olivia, Mn.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 24.9 mm (1 in) more which is equivalent to 24.9 l/m² (0.61 US gal/ft²) or 249,000 l/ha (26,620 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.2° lower in Olivia, Mn than in Segou.
